### Nightly Reindex — Notes

The Corvane search reindex runs nightly at 02:10, rebuilding the full index from the documents store before swapping aliases. If the build fails, the old index stays live and an alert fires. Future maintainers: don't change the swap step without review. Questions about the job's behavior go to the owner listed below.

named custodian: Brivan Eliath Quenox Frador

Subject: Key rotation — Ordervault soft-delete worker

Team,

Rotating the Ordervault credential today. The soft-delete worker that flags rows in the orders table will fail auth after 17:00 unless updated. Release manager: update the deploy config before tonight's cut. Old key is revoked at rotation, no grace period. The new key is below.

gateway credential: kto3_qfe

Tuning notes for the ScanBridge barcode module. Most misreads reported by field teams trace back to scan timeout and decode retry settings, not hardware. Before swapping a unit, adjust the values in scanbridge.conf and retest with the Kestrel sample sheet. Lower the debounce interval only on high-speed conveyor installs; raising it helps handheld units in low light. Defaults work for 90% of deployments. The shipping defaults are listed below.

tuning table, yajog-yahof:
BUDGETS = {
    "lamvan": 303,
    "wenox": 460,
    "fenvan": 525,
}